VSO is the worldโs leading international non-governmental organisation that works through volunteers to create a fair world for everyone. In 2022/23, over 7,700 dedicated individuals from across the globe volunteered with VSO, bringing their abilities to support almost 11 million people in 35 countries.
Our work centres on those who are left out by society โ those living in extreme poverty or with disability and illness. Those who face discrimination and violence because of their gender, sexuality, or social status. Those who are at risk from disaster, disease, and conflict.
But they are not passive beneficiaries of aid; they are the โprimary actorsโ at the heart of our efforts. From their perspective, we define the issues, opportunities, and solutions that drive sustainable, local-led change. These individuals are the key agents of their own transformation.

Role Overview Summary
The Peace Building & DRR Advisor provides technical expertise, capacity building and accompaniment on conflict sensitivity, peacebuilding, social cohesion, disaster risk management and inclusion in the IPDHE project (Integrating Peacebuilding, Development, and Humanitarian Efforts) in Moyale, Kenya.
Ideal Applicant Summary
Competencies and Behaviour:
Extensive experience in peacebuilding, disaster management, and resilience-focused community development in fragile or conflict-affected settings. Skilled in facilitating participatory and inclusive approaches using diverse methods. Proven ability in capacity building, empowering youth and primary actors to engage as active citizens. Competent in monitoring and evaluation data collection and narrative reporting. Familiar with work in Moyale, Kenya, especially along the Ethiopia-Kenya border.
